Halloween Coding - Spooky Brew - Students will program actors so that they transform in different ways when fed a mysterious potion. As students create this potion-making game, they will program what effect will their potion have on a monster? Will it turn the monster into a fire-breathing dragon? Transform the monster into a spooky skeleton? Or make the monster change in size?

Technology Competency: Multimedia
Standard: Create visual animated presentations
Activity 4: Powtoon Introduction - This week students sign up and learn the components of powtoon (Stage, Slide Panel, Timeline, Sound control button, Tabs, Stage Tools, Top Bar), create a practice PowToon and learn to use the tools, name, save and share the file. Students also learn to use voice recorder tools.
